在软件开发过程中,测试用例是确保产品质量的关键环节。它是一种详细说明,描述了如何对软件功能进行测试,包括预期输入、执行步骤以及期望的输出结果。本篇将深入探讨“软件测试用例-编写模板”及其在Excel模式中的应用。
一、测试用例的重要性
1. 确保覆盖:测试用例设计旨在覆盖软件的所有关键功能和边界条件,避免遗漏可能导致问题的路径。
2. 明确标准:为测试人员提供明确的执行指南,减少主观性和误判。
3. 可追溯性:记录每次测试的结果,便于问题定位和修复后的验证。
4. 提升效率:通过标准化的模板,可以快速创建和维护测试用例,提高测试效率。
二、测试用例编写模板的构成
1. 用例编号:唯一标识每个测试用例,方便管理和跟踪。
2. 功能描述:简述被测试的功能或需求。
3. 预置条件:执行测试用例前必须满足的环境或状态。
4. 输入/操作:详细说明测试时需要提供的输入数据或执行的操作。
5. 预期结果:预期系统应如何响应输入,包括正常情况和异常情况。
6. 测试步骤:按照顺序列出执行测试的每一步骤。
7. 结果验证:实际测试结果与预期结果的比较,可包括判断标准。
8. 缺陷记录:如果发现的问题,记录详细信息,如错误类型、影响程度等。
9. 优先级和复杂度:根据业务重要性和测试难度设定,指导测试资源分配。
10. 优先级和状态:表示测试用例的执行顺序和当前状态(如未执行、执行中、已通过、已失败)。
三、Excel模式的测试用例管理
1. 表格结构:利用Excel的行列布局,清晰地展示测试用例的各个要素。
2. 条目排序:通过排序功能,可以根据优先级、功能模块或状态调整测试用例的顺序。
3. 公式和函数:使用Excel的计算功能,可以统计通过率、缺陷率等指标。
4. 滤镜和条件格式:筛选特定状态的用例,或通过颜色高亮突出关键信息。
5. 数据链接:与其他Excel工作表或外部系统连接,实现数据共享和同步。
6. 模板复用:创建标准模板,方便快速生成新的测试用例文档。
7. 版本控制:如“测试用例_V1.0.xls”,标明不同版本,便于追踪修改历史。
四、使用测试用例模板的实践建议
1. 定期审查:定期更新和优化模板,以适应项目需求变化。
2. 团队协作:确保所有团队成员理解和遵循模板,提高沟通效率。
3. 自动化集成:考虑与自动化测试工具集成,减轻手动测试的工作量。
4. 文档规范:保持文档整洁,使用统一的术语和格式。
5. 持续改进:根据测试反馈,不断优化测试用例设计,提升测试质量。
综上,一个有效的“软件测试用例-编写模板”是软件质量保障体系的重要组成部分。通过Excel模式,我们可以更好地组织、管理和执行测试用例,从而提高软件开发的效率和可靠性。在实际操作中,应结合具体项目需求,灵活运用并不断优化模板,确保测试工作的高效进行。